While Selena Gomez didn't actually sing "Him & I" (that’s a 2017 hit by G-Eazy and Halsey about their real-life romance), the internet decided they were meant to be together. Producers like Ian Asher and darkvidez have layered the upbeat, rebellious spirit of "Him & I" over the melancholic, synth-driven bridge of Selena's from her album Rare . This track is all about the intense, "Bonnie and Clyde" style loyalty. It represents that phase of a relationship where you feel invincible and completely intertwined with someone else.

Selena’s track captures the jarring reality of how fast that intensity can fade. Her iconic line, "We used to be close, but people can go from people you know to people you don't," serves as a sobering reminder of how strangers can become everything—and then become strangers again.
